Некоторые преимущества использования кэша запросов в MySQL:
- Ускорение извлечения данных. 34 Кэш сохраняет в памяти операторы SELECT с извлечёнными записями. 3 Если позже клиент отправляет идентичный запрос, данные выводятся быстрее, поскольку не нужно повторно выполнять команды в базе данных. 3
- Снижение нагрузки на сервер. 14 Кэширование эффективно для часто выполняемых запросов с постоянными параметрами. 4
- Улучшение масштабируемости приложений. 1 Грамотно настроенное кэширование позволяет снизить нагрузку на сервер и ускорить обработку повторяющихся запросов. 1
- Экономия серверных ресурсов. 1 Это особенно важно для бизнес-проектов, которым необходимо большое количество данных. 1
Однако кэширование не всегда обосновано. 1 В системах с интенсивным изменением данных результаты запросов часто обладают ограниченным сроком актуальности. 1 В таких условиях при повторном обращении к информации кэш может содержать устаревшие данные, что снизит его эффективность. 1